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 12 Aug 2019 14:16:56 +0000 (UTC)
From:      MANTANI Nobutaka <nobutaka@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r508741 - in head/editors/semi: . files
Message-ID:  <201908121416.x7CEGuCn095776@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: nobutaka
Date: Mon Aug 12 14:16:56 2019
New Revision: 508741
URL: https://svnweb.freebsd.org/changeset/ports/508741

Log:
  - Switch to the version maintained by the developers of Wanderlust.
  - Update to the snapshot on 2019-07-08.

Deleted:
  head/editors/semi/files/_pkg.el
  head/editors/semi/files/patch-SEMI-CFG
  head/editors/semi/files/patch-mime-ui-en.texi
Modified:
  head/editors/semi/Makefile
  head/editors/semi/distinfo
  head/editors/semi/files/patch-mime-ui-ja.texi
  head/editors/semi/pkg-descr
  head/editors/semi/pkg-plist

Modified: head/editors/semi/Makefile
==============================================================================
--- head/editors/semi/Makefile	Mon Aug 12 14:14:54 2019	(r508740)
+++ head/editors/semi/Makefile	Mon Aug 12 14:16:56 2019	(r508741)
@@ -2,10 +2,8 @@
 # $FreeBSD$
 
 PORTNAME=	semi
-PORTVERSION=	${SEMI_VER}
-PORTREVISION=	23
+PORTVERSION=	${SEMI_VER}.${SNAPDATE}
 CATEGORIES=	editors elisp
-MASTER_SITES=	http://git.chise.org/elisp/dist/semi/semi-1.14-for-flim-1.14/
 PKGNAMESUFFIX=	${EMACS_PKGNAMESUFFIX}
 
 MAINTAINER=	nobutaka@FreeBSD.org
@@ -13,12 +11,15 @@ COMMENT=	SEMI, Library of MIME feature for GNU Emacs f
 
 LICENSE=	GPLv2
 
-BUILD_DEPENDS=	flim${EMACS_PKGNAMESUFFIX}>0:editors/flim@${EMACS_FLAVOR} \
-		nkf:japanese/nkf
+BUILD_DEPENDS=	flim${EMACS_PKGNAMESUFFIX}>0:editors/flim@${EMACS_FLAVOR}
 RUN_DEPENDS=	flim${EMACS_PKGNAMESUFFIX}>0:editors/flim@${EMACS_FLAVOR}
 
-USES=		emacs makeinfo
+USES=		emacs iconv makeinfo
+USE_GITHUB=	yes
+GH_ACCOUNT=	wanderlust
+GH_TAGNAME=	16228dc
 
+SNAPDATE=	20190708
 NO_ARCH=	yes
 
 FLIM_TRUNK=	1.14
@@ -38,8 +39,8 @@ OPTIONS_DEFINE=	DOCS
 post-build:
 	@(cd ${WRKSRC} ; \
 	for i in mime-ui-en.texi mime-ui-ja.texi; do \
-		${CAT} $${i} | nkf -e > $${i}.jis ; \
-		${MAKEINFO} --no-split --no-validate $${i}.jis ; \
+		${ICONV_CMD} -f ISO-2022-JP -t UTF-8 $${i} > $${i}.utf8 ; \
+		${MAKEINFO} --no-split --no-validate $${i}.utf8 ; \
 	done)
 
 post-install:

Modified: head/editors/semi/distinfo
==============================================================================
--- head/editors/semi/distinfo	Mon Aug 12 14:14:54 2019	(r508740)
+++ head/editors/semi/distinfo	Mon Aug 12 14:16:56 2019	(r508741)
@@ -1,2 +1,3 @@
-SHA256 (semi-1.14.6.tar.gz) = 717fe9261863b2a36cf5882cc669452848d6b91f48ce6a695d81118500ed1bfb
-SIZE (semi-1.14.6.tar.gz) = 142549
+TIMESTAMP = 1565575398
+SHA256 (wanderlust-semi-1.14.6.20190708-16228dc_GH0.tar.gz) = 8b27eb7e3ab4d2a250237b496c77cf89a77d583e484c577c99448535abb52228
+SIZE (wanderlust-semi-1.14.6.20190708-16228dc_GH0.tar.gz) = 153183

Modified: head/editors/semi/files/patch-mime-ui-ja.texi
==============================================================================
--- head/editors/semi/files/patch-mime-ui-ja.texi	Mon Aug 12 14:14:54 2019	(r508740)
+++ head/editors/semi/files/patch-mime-ui-ja.texi	Mon Aug 12 14:16:56 2019	(r508741)
@@ -1,14 +1,10 @@
---- mime-ui-ja.texi.orig	2002-10-15 06:59:21 UTC
+--- mime-ui-ja.texi.orig	2019-08-11 16:55:18 UTC
 +++ mime-ui-ja.texi
-@@ -1,6 +1,10 @@
+@@ -1,6 +1,6 @@
  \input texinfo.tex
  @setfilename mime-ui-ja.info
--@settitle{SEMI 1.14 $B@bL@=q(B}
-+@settitle SEMI 1.14 $B@bL@=q(B
-+@dircategory The Emacs editor and associated tools 
-+@direntry 
-+* mime-ui-ja: (mime-ui-ja).	MIME user interface for GNU Emacs. (Japanese)
-+@end direntry 
- @titlepage
- @title SEMI 1.14 $B@bL@=q(B
- @author $B<i2,(B $BCNI'(B <morioka@@jaist.ac.jp>
+-@documentencoding iso-2022-jp
++@documentencoding utf-8
+ @documentlanguage ja
+ 
+ @dircategory GNU Emacs Lisp

Modified: head/editors/semi/pkg-descr
==============================================================================
--- head/editors/semi/pkg-descr	Mon Aug 12 14:14:54 2019	(r508740)
+++ head/editors/semi/pkg-descr	Mon Aug 12 14:16:56 2019	(r508741)
@@ -20,4 +20,4 @@ SEMI, Library of MIME feature for GNU Emacs for emacs2
 
 Ported by shige@FreeBSD.ORG
 
-WWW: http://git.chise.org/elisp/semi/ (in Japanese)
+WWW: https://github.com/wanderlust/semi

Modified: head/editors/semi/pkg-plist
==============================================================================
--- head/editors/semi/pkg-plist	Mon Aug 12 14:14:54 2019	(r508740)
+++ head/editors/semi/pkg-plist	Mon Aug 12 14:16:56 2019	(r508741)
@@ -13,21 +13,16 @@
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-play.elc
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-setup.el
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-setup.elc
+%%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-shr.el
+%%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-shr.elc
+%%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-signature.el
+%%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-signature.elc
+%%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-tnef.el
+%%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-tnef.elc
+%%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-vcard.el
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-view.el
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-view.elc
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/mime-w3.el
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-def.el
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-def.elc
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-gpg.el
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-gpg.elc
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-parse.el
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-parse.elc
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-pgp.el
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-pgp.elc
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-pgp5.el
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g-pgp5.elc
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g.el
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/pgg.elc
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/postpet.el
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/postpet.elc
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/semi-def.el
@@ -36,8 +31,6 @@
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/semi-setup.elc
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/signature.el
 %%EMACS_VERSION_SITE_LISPDIR%%/semi/signature.elc
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/smime.el
-%%EMACS_VERSION_SITE_LISPDIR%%/semi/smime.elc
 %%PORTDOCS%%%%DOCSDIR%%/ChangeLog
 %%PORTDOCS%%%%DOCSDIR%%/NEWS
 %%PORTDOCS%%%%DOCSDIR%%/README.en



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201908121416.x7CEGuCn095776>